5 big things in AI that happened this week: Apple developing AI chips, US lawmakers announce new bill, Meta expands AI tools, Google Deepmind unveils new AI model, and Google brings Circle to Search to iPhone

Apple is reportedly developing artificial intelligence software in data centers, with the project codenamed Project ACDC (Apple Chips in Data Center). The company is leveraging its chip design expertise to create the infrastructure necessary for running AI models. According to a Reuters report, the collaboration with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co has been ongoing for several years.

US lawmakers introduce a new bill

A bipartisan group of US lawmakers introduced a bill empowering the Biden administration to impose export restrictions on AI models to safeguard American technology. The bill grants the Commerce Department express authority to prevent US companies from collaborating with foreign entities on AI projects, as detailed in a Reuters report.

Meta Platforms expands AI offerings

Meta Platforms announced the expansion of its generative AI-based tool for advertisers. This enhancement provides users with advanced AI capabilities that automatically generate image variations and overlay text on them, according to a Reuters report. The tool includes features such as image and text generation, as well as creating video ads for Reels, facilitated by the Meta AI assistant.

Google Deepmind introduces AlphaFold version 3

Google Deepmind unveiled the third iteration of its AI model, AlphaFold, enabling scientists to design drugs effectively. By understanding how proteins interact with other molecules, researchers can develop new medications with precision. Demis Hassabis, CEO of DeepMind, emphasized the significance of designing molecules that bind to specific proteins to aid in disease treatment, according to a Reuters report.

Google brings Circle to Search to iPhone

Following its availability on Samsung and Pixel devices, Google announced that the AI-driven Circle to Search feature is now accessible to iPhone users. By updating to iOS version 17.4 and selecting the Search your screenshot option in the Google app, iPhone users can activate this feature for efficient search functionality.
